Experimental Center of Tropical Forestry Provides Technical Assistance for Sustainable Forestry in Cambodia
Author:     Time: 2019-01-02

 

 

On December 20th, the “Integrated Replanting Nitrogen-Fixing Precious Tree Species and Thinning for Reforestation and Sustainable Management of Degraded Forests” hosted by the Experimental Center of Tropical Forestry of the CAF was launched in Siem Reap, Cambodia. The project is funded by the Asia-Pacific Network for Sustainable Forest Management and Rehabilitation (APFNet). The Experimental Center of Tropical Forestry is the project executing agency, and the Forest and Wildlife Development Institute of the Forestry Administration of Cambodia is the implementing agency. Sie Ra, deputy director of the Forestry Bureau of the Ministry of Agriculture, Forestry and Fisheries of Cambodia, Tea Kimsoth, director of the Agriculture, Forestry and Fisheries Bureau of the Siem Reap Province, and Zhang Zhongtian, deputy director of the APFNet attended and spoke at the project initiating meeting.

At the meeting, Zhang Zhongtian, deputy director of the APFNet, Cai Daoxiong, director of the Experimental Center of Tropical Forestry of the CAF, and Sokh Heng, director of the Cambodian Forest and Wildlife Development Institute, signed the project agreement on behalf of the project funding agency, executing agency and implementing agency, respectively.

The project leader Cai Daoxiong provided a briefing on the project at the meeting, introduced in detail the purpose, significance, and main activities of the project. Dr. KAO Dan, Deputy Director of the Community Forestry Management Office of the Forestry Administration of Cambodia gave a report titled “Policies for Cambodia Forest Management and Support”; Professor Guo Wenfu from the Experimental Center of Tropical Forestry of the CAF presented an academic report titled “Degraded Forest Restoration and Sustainable Management Strategy, A Case Study on the Experimental Center of Tropical Forestry”; and Heng Da from the Center for People and Forests (RECOFTC) gave an academic report on "The Support and Promotion of Sustainable Forest Management in Community Forestry and Reforestation". APFNet project officials made a report titled "Promoting Sustainable Forest Management and Restoration in Cambodia through APFNet Projects" and discussed the status of APFNet’s projects in Cambodia and their achievements. The participants discussed the project at the meeting.

After the meeting, APFNet and the China-Cambodia project team went to the community forest of Baota Village in Siem Reap Province to conduct field surveys and interviewed farmers and villagers in the village.

A total of 50 people from the APFNet, the Forestry Administration of Cambodia, the Siem Reap Forestry Administration, Khnar Pou Community, Baota Village, and the Experimental Center of Tropical Forestry of the CAF attended the initiating meeting.

The “Integrated Replanting Nitrogen-Fixing Precious Tree Species and Thinning for Reforestation and Sustainable Management of Degraded Forests” project was funded by APFNet. A demonstration forest was set up in a degraded community forest in Khnar Pou Community, Soutr Nikom District, Siem Reap Province, Cambodia as a pilot study site for carrying out technical training and improve Cambodian forest resource restoration and sustainable forestry.
